Navigating the Legal Framework for Foreign Investors in Mexico

Foreign investors have a clear path to owning property in Mexico, thanks to its welcoming legal framework. Understanding these laws is crucial for a smooth investment process. Mexico’s laws are designed to protect foreign investors and ensure a straightforward property buying experience.

Key Legal Considerations for Foreign Investors:

  • The Fideicomiso system allows foreigners to own property near the coast and borders.
  • Direct ownership is possible in most other areas of Mexico.
  • Foreigners need to obtain a permit from the Mexican Foreign Affairs Ministry.
  • The importance of a reputable local lawyer to navigate the process.
  • Mexico’s transparent property registration system.
  • No restrictions on the sale or rental of owned property.
  • The potential for residency through investment.
  • Legal protections against expropriation.

With the right guidance, investing in Mexican real estate can be a secure and profitable decision for foreigners.

The Impact of Tourism on Property Values in Mexico

Mexican Property: Investment Opportunities in Emerging Markets - yunglava (3)

Tourism is a major driver of property values in Mexico. Areas popular with tourists, like Cancun, Playa del Carmen, and Tulum, have seen significant increases in property values. The continuous flow of tourists ensures a high demand for rental properties, making real estate investment in these areas particularly appealing.

Is it safe for Americans to buy property in Mexico? ›

Foreigners can own property in Mexico. It's perfectly legal. Outside the restricted zones—50 kilometers (about 31 miles) from shorelines and 100 kilometers (about 62 miles) from international borders—foreigners can hold direct deed to property with the same rights and responsibilities as Mexican nationals.

Do homeowners pay property tax in Mexico? ›

Another tax requirement for homebuyers in Mexico is the annual property tax, called Predial. This tax must be paid annually and is due no later than March 31. On a positive note, this amount is usually low and is calculated based on the size and location of the property you're buying.

Are property taxes high in Mexico? ›

Property taxes vary by state in Mexico but can range anywhere from 2-5% at the point of sale, but only 0.25% up to 2% of the property value per year for annual Mexican predial property taxes.
